Understanding Jacob Bronowski
Jacob Bronowski was born in 1908 in Poland and later moved to England, where he became a significant intellectual figure in the mid-20th century. His diverse background in mathematics, the sciences, and the arts enabled him to bridge the gap between these domains. Bronowski is perhaps best known for his television series "The Ascent of Man," which aired in the 1970s. This series not only showcased the development of human knowledge through the lens of science but also underscored the moral responsibilities that come with scientific advancements.
Philosophical Foundations
Bronowski's philosophy is deeply rooted in humanism, which posits that human beings are capable of self-realization and ethical decision-making. He argued that science should not be viewed as an isolated discipline but rather as an integral part of human culture. His ideas can be summarized in several key philosophical tenets:
1. Unity of Knowledge: Bronowski believed that knowledge is interconnected. Scientific discoveries cannot be separated from the cultural and ethical contexts in which they arise.
2. Human Experience: He asserted that science must reflect the human experience. The scientific method, while objective, is applied by subjective human beings whose values and emotions play a crucial role in shaping scientific inquiry.
3. Moral Responsibility: With the power of scientific knowledge comes the responsibility to use it ethically. Bronowski was acutely aware of the dangers posed by misapplying science, as exemplified in the contexts of warfare and environmental degradation.

Science as a Human Endeavor
For Bronowski, science is not merely a collection of facts or a series of experiments; it is a profoundly human endeavor. He emphasized that:
- Creativity: Scientific discovery is a creative process, akin to art. Scientists must use imagination to formulate hypotheses and interpret data.
- Collaboration: Scientific progress often hinges on collaboration across various fields, cultures, and disciplines. This interconnectedness reinforces the importance of shared human values.
- Critical Thinking: The scientific method encourages skepticism and critical thinking, which are essential for moral reasoning. As scientists question existing paradigms, they also challenge ethical norms, leading to societal evolution.
